Title:  Frank Lloyd Wright at Florida Southern College

Description:   Frank Lloyd Wright was commissioned by Florida Southern
                      College President Lud Spivey to design an architecturally
                      integrated campus for the college. Wright designed 18
                      structures for his "Child of the Sun Campus," twelve of which
                      were eventually built.  Wright visited the Florida Southern
                      campus in late 1938 to check on the progress of his "Child of
                      the Sun."  Dan Sanborn captured that visit on film.
